THE Premier, Barry O'Farrell, has been branded a hypocrite for welcoming the establishment in Sydney of the headquarters of a $10 billion clean energy fund, despite it being bankrolled by the carbon tax and a pledge by the federal Coalition to abolish it.Mr O'Farrell and the Prime Minister, Julia Gillard, yesterday announced the Clean Energy Finance Corporation would be located in Sydney, producing 40 jobs.
Mr O'Farrell has been a vociferous opponent of the carbon tax, which he has argued will damage the NSW economy. Last year the NSW government claimed it would cost billions of dollars in lost revenue and thousands of jobs.But yesterday Mr O'Farrell said the CEFC, which will be funded by revenue from the tax, would be a boost to the economy and thanked Ms Gillard for choosing Sydney.
''It is the natural home for the Clean Energy Finance Corporation and will be a welcome addition to Sydney's financial sector,'' he said.Mr O'Farrell defended his support for the CEFC, arguing it was his job as Premier to welcome new jobs to the state, but he declined to say whether he supported the federal Coalition policy to abolish the corporation in government.

The Liberal National Party (LNP) is facing another pre-selection embarrassment on Queensland's Gold Coast after reports its candidate for the seat of Albert, Mark Boothman, ran a pornography website.

Mr Boothman is standing for the LNP against Labor's sitting member Margaret Keech.

Ms Keech holds the seat with a 6.5 per cent margin.

The Gold Coast Bulletin newspaper is reporting Mr Boothman was the administrator of a pornography website that was set up in 2003.

He is quoted as saying he helped a friend with the design of the site and was also an administrative contact.

Neither the LNP's president or Mr Boothman have returned the ABC's calls.
